## Onboarding: Turnstile Counter Service

For this week's sync: the Gatewick counter service tallies entries at Hollowmere Stadium in near real time. Each turnstile pushes a pulse to the edge collector, which batches counts every five seconds into the central store. Discrepancies over 2% against ticket scans trigger an alert to the ops channel. To query raw pulse data during a review, connect using the string below.

primary connection of yagep-kahip = redis://giliel_svc:zYiKsLL2PLpfPL@db-348f.xolmarsys.corp:5432/fenwyn

Ticket: Gateway rate limiter rejects bursts below configured threshold. On Brindlecore's internal gateway, the token bucket refill runs per-node rather than cluster-wide, so services behind the Quillway mesh hit 429s at roughly half the documented limit. New folks: reproduce with the synthetic burst script in the tools repo, staging only. Fix likely means moving counters to the shared cache tier. The failing trace was captured under the token below.

pipeline stamp: htk9_ce63042d9

/*
 * MAX_PROCTOR_QUEUE_DEPTH caps pending sessions in the Vigilant
 * exam-proctoring queue. Raising it past 500 overloaded the Ashgrove
 * review pods during the winter pilot, so treat changes as a release
 * blocker requiring load-test sign-off. For the release manager: the
 * last validated build for this value is noted below.
 */

pipeline stamp: htk3_69f